Subodh Roy is an Indian politician who served as Member of 13th Lok Sabha from Bhagalpur Lok Sabha constituency[1] and Member of 14th and 15th Bihar Legislative Assembly from Sultanganj Assembly constituency.[2][3] In 1998 Indian general election, he got 47.94%[4] or 3,21,159 votes.[5]

Personal life[edit]

He was born on 18 July 1942 in Bhagalpur district.[6]
